Southeast Polk is the No. 1 team in the High School Football America Iowa Top 10 heading into the postseason. The Rams finish the regular season with an 8-1 record with their only loss to No. 3 Ankeny.

Last year, Ankeny beat Southeast Polk for the 4A state champ. SEP heads into the new 5A classification, which has seven team in our statewide rankings powered by NFL Play Football.

Related: Iowa 1st & 2nd Round Playoff Matchups

The biggest opening round playoff game will be in Class 5A Pod two where No. 2 Iowa City will square-off with No. 6 Urbandale, which is coming-off a 17-16 loss to Northwest (Waukee).
